プログラミング入門

独学で学習するのであればPHPからプログラミングを学ぼう

プログラミング初心者にオススメ!PHPを学ぼう

  シェア   0

PHPはHTMLに埋め込んで使用が出来るため、WebサービスやWebアプリ開発で使用される人気のあるプログラミング言語。記述法も英語に近いため、初心者が独学でも勉強がしやすいと言われています。今回はスクリプト言語のPHPについてお伝えします。

PHPとは


Perlなどのスクリプト言語よりもPHPは、手軽に使えることから様々なWEBアプリ開発をする際に幅広く使用されています。PHPは、サーバーサイドの言語になります。サーバーでは、Webクライアントから送られて来たリクエストに対し、そのリクエストに合うデータを用意し、データをクライアント側に送り返します。そのデータがクライアント側で表示され、Web上で可視することができるようになります。

PHPは、このサーバーの伝達の部分を担っています。一方HTMLやJavaScriptは、クライアントサイドの言語なので、サーバーとは交信しません。これが、PHPを始めとしたサーバーサイドの言語と、HTMLやJavaScriptといったクライアントサイドの言語の大きな違いです。

PHPは独学でも学べるのか

PHPは他のプログラミング言語よりも比較的学びやすいと言語とされています。プログラミング初心者が独学で言語を学ぶことで、一番の大きな障壁になるのは分からなくなった場合に情報が少なすぎ挫折してしまう事になります。確かに、プログラミングを独学だけで学ぶのには、簡単に習得できるものはありません。
しかし、コストをかけずに挫折しない様にするためには、学びやすい言語であることが大前提です。そのため。PHPは初心者に最適だと言われる理由は、まずは情報量が多いことになります。世界で最も使われているプログラミング言語の一つのため、利用人口が多い事で、関連する書籍やインターネット上に無料の情報も簡単に手に入れる事が出来ます。

独学であろうと、スクールに通っている生徒であっても、プログラミングを勉強していれば、必ずつまずき意味を理解するのに時間を要することが出てきます。その時に、参考になる情報をいち早く、手に入ることはができるだけの情報が提供されているのが大きなメリットとなります。

また、PHPは、Facebookの開発などのWebサービスや、wordpressで運営されるブログなど、PHPで構築されている物が数多く存在しています。レンタルサーバーを使用したり、他にWebサービスを利用する際に、PHPが全く使えないという場合もあり得ません。

また、クラウドソーシングなどでもPHPの求人の需要が高く、今後も求人に困るような事態にはならないでしょう。そのため、PHPを扱えるエンジニアになる事で、安定した収益を上げる事も、フリーランスでもやっていける需要が高い分類の言語だとされています。

まとめ

PHPは基本的なことを理解することで、Javaなどのプログラミング言語よりも、比較優しいレベルの言語となりますので、独学にも最適でもあります。ただし、プログラミングをマスターするにはそれ相応の努力が必要にはなります。
また、Web開発の現場でも多く使われており、クラウドワークスやランサーズなどのクラウドソーシングでも案件数は多く受注できるサービスです。個人で受託開発が可能となるので、初心者がプログラミングを独学や、スクールで学ぶ言語としては悪い選択ではありません。